Burmese NGOs lobby for aid delivery rethink

Updated August 24, 2009 12:03:41

A delegation of Burmese doctors and human rights activists, visiting Australia, is calling for a change to the way aid money is given to Burma. The group is calling for AusAID assistance to be re-directed towards the thousands of internally displaced people living in Burma's east, saying without support for medical services, hundreds of people will die needlessly.
